As a Quality Manager, or Quality Assurance Manager, you would oversee quality and the production process to make sure that all products meet consistent standards. Duties include developing quality team, managing QMS, implementing quality control tests, inspecting products at various stages, and writing reports documenting production issues.
Essential Functions:
1. Maintains ISO certification and upgrades to higher quality standards according to business needs.
2. Manages the Quality Assurance function by developing and maintaining quality systems, including PPAP’s, FMEA’s, product testing and development.
3. Manage PPAP and PFMEA development on all new and existing processes.
4. Works closely with associates on the floor to address all non-conformance and SCAR issues. Organizes and leads a team of quality and production personnel to implement, monitor and close out corrective actions.
5. Point of contact for customers for all quality related issues.
6. Develops and leads cross functional teams to drive and implement continuous improvement using Quality tools.
7. On a consistent, day-to-day basis works with associates on the floor by organizing and participating in discussions, meetings, and training.
8. Manages Quality Control function by directing the activities of the quality coordinator, technicians, leads and inspectors. Mentors’ quality team members for professional development.
9. Develops and analyzes statistical data and product specifications to determine standards and to establish quality and reliability expectancy of finished products.
10. Provide technical and statistical expertise to teams.
11. Design, develop and implement quality control training programs.
12. Manages priorities, goal setting, and action planning for the technical support group in accordance with business strategies.
13. Actively participates on Management Team
